Transit Visa for Sri Lankan who has a PR Card in Canada

Hello:

I am a Canadian permanent resident (PR) and holding Sri Lankan passport. I have an air ticket connecting in Hong Kong and Beijing. I am not going to come out of the terminal however I may have to spent couple of hours to get in to connecting flight. Do I need a “Transit type” if yes, how and where to apply. Please note I am living in Alberta, Canada.

Yes, you should apply for a transit type in advance. You can choose to apply from HK Immigration Department directly or Chinese embassy/consulate that has jurisdiction over your city. Please submit your application at least 4 to 6 weeks before you leave. If embassy deals with your application, it takes four working days. If your application was sent to HK, then it takes four weeks at least.
